What it costs to live here
Against the national average, Nevada runs housing 14% above and utilities 9% below. (Bureau of Economic Analysis regional price parities, Nevada, 2024.)
| Category | vs. national average |
| Overall | at par |
| Housing | 14% above |
| Utilities | 9% below |
| Groceries and goods | 4% below |
| Services | 1% below |
HUD fair market rent for a two-bedroom in Las Vegas is $1,835 a month (2025, utilities included); a one-bedroom is $1,550.
Nevada levies no state income tax on wages.

Common questions
- Do I need a Nevada license to work in Las Vegas?
- Nevada is not a Nurse Licensure Compact state, so you need a Nevada license to work here even if you hold a multistate license.

- Does Nevada tax travel nurse pay?
- Nevada levies no state income tax on wages, so only federal tax comes off the taxable base of a package. Stipends are not wages; what counts as a stipend depends on your tax home.
